CE.NET 4.2 doesn't interprets Alt plus NumericPad keys ( e.g ALT + 0128 )
as the Euro sign. I used different and additional fonts, but everytime I got
only an j

I use an USB keyboard, Standard O/S locale in English.

Does someone know more?

Try seeing exactly which Unicode character is being generated in the WM_CHAR
message. If you use the kbdtest app (sysgen kbdtest), you can watch the
WM_CHAR messages in PB's output window. Also try ALT+0128 to see if the
results differ.
